Golden Age: Wagner & R. Strauss
Pairing the two German composers, Wagner and the Wagnerian Strauss in a single evening creates a sweeping and overwhelming fusion of expansive melodies and driving dramatic force. The encounter between Wagner’s mythical intensity and Strauss’s modernism is a dialogue between two musical giants who reshaped not only German but also international musical life. In the performance of the OPERA Orchestra, their compositions promise deep emotions, dense musical textures, and sonic grandeur.

Programme
Wagner: Der fliegende Holländer – overture and The Dutchman’s monologue
R. Strauss: Symphonische Fantasie aus Die Frau ohne Schatten
- Interval -
R. Strauss: Also sprach Zarathustra
Conductor: Péter Halász
Featuring the Hungarian State Opera Orchestra
Running time 2 hours including one interval
